I saw that files such as /tmp/ccxFKYeS.target.o kept accumulating. Not a high number, but still several. I turned out that when compiling an offloading program successfully, they were removed. But when it failed, those remained. (Example: See PR.) This patch fixes this by storing the file name earlier and process them during cleanup, unless they have been taken care of before. (Usual way; as they are printf'ed to stdout, I assume the caller takes care of the tmp files.) OK for mainline?
